HED’s Women in Architecture + Engineering + Design (WiA+ED) Employee Resource Group begins 2026 with renewed energy and an open invitation to staff across all offices.
Led by co-chairs Melina Aluwi AIA, LEED AP and Patsy Shigetomi AIA, IIDA, NCIDQ, LEED AP, WiA+ED continues its mission to foster a more diverse and inclusive profession by empowering women through leadership development, career resources, and a strong peer network. The group works to elevate visibility, cultivate belonging, and inspire women to shape the future of design.
As HED grows, so does the opportunity to deepen connection. With many new team members joining since the last session in 2025, WiA+ED is expanding its reach and inviting staff to participate in upcoming events and conversations. Meeting invitations and communications will be shared with those who opt in, reinforcing the group’s commitment to intentional engagement and meaningful dialogue.
WiA+ED reflects HED’s broader belief that thoughtful leadership begins from within. By investing in mentorship, shared experience, and collective momentum, the group strengthens not only individual careers, but the culture of the firm itself.
